The problem

Freelancers and agencies finish projects and need to hand the code over to the client or their in-house team. Writing handover documentation takes hours. You need to explain the architecture, list the technologies, document the API endpoints, describe how to set up the dev environment, and give an overview of every major feature.

Most developers skip parts because it takes too long. The client ends up with incomplete docs and calls you back with questions for weeks.
